Technoclassica 7-11 April 2010 Essen/Germany: 40 Years Citroën GS/SM, “sportlich unterwegs”, VIP Robert Opron

Just a few days to go: from 7-11 April 2010, world’s biggest vintage car show, the “Technoclassica” in Essen (Ruhrgebiet) will be welcoming more than 170,000 people from more than 40 countries who are expected to visit this year’s promising event. With over 1,000 exhibitors, all the 20 halls with more than 110,000 square meters of exhibition space are fully booked. The more than 300 car dealers will have no less than 2,500 vintage, classic and prestige automobiles and young classics for sale. And more than 200 clubs will be there, making TECHNO-CLASSICA ESSEN the largest classic car club forum in the world this year, too.

The German association of all Citroën car clubs, the “Citroën-Strasse”, will be prominently visible again in Hall 9.1 on their 400 sq.m. booth, this year focusing on some great highlights of the famous brand:

  • 40 Jahre Citroën SM / Citroën GS:

    Salon de l'Auto 1970

    this anniversary exhibition will display 5-6 cars and focus on the most important highlights of the very prestigious SM “Grand Tourisme” Coupé as well as on the little big brother, the GS middle class model. The clubs provide an interesting retrospective: we will show a stunning GS cutaway engine and gearbox, some interior details, historic videos from publications and the Citroen archives and of course many details from those years.

    Furthermore, as the GS has been elected as the “European Car Of The Year 1971″, we will have a “GS Drapeau” on show.

  • VIP guests:

    Robert Opron, Bureau des Etudes

    Robert Opron

    Mr. Robert Opron, the great Citroën designer and stylist eg. of the new 1967 DS headlights, the SM, GS and CX at the weekend; we are proud to have received his confirmation to our invitation to the show. Certainly one if not *the* highlight to meet one of the brains behind the style and creativity of Automobiles Citroën! Mr. Opron will give some insights into his works as some of the original 3D models he has been working on, will be presented on the stand as well – a “first time” within Germany!

Our partner: the “Automobiles Citroën” booth

The stand of “Citroen-Strasse” will be complemented by another very exciting presentation of the German subsidiary of Automobiles Citroën, Citroën Deutschland GmbH, which will present on their booth in Hall 4 a stunning selection of cars from the Conservatoire and also from the French government:

  • The “Citroën SM Présidentielle”, one of the 2 original cars from the Paris Elysée governmental palace, will be shown. A first time ever that this exciting prestigious convertible is now on a show in Germany!
  • The “GS Energetique” a famous and unique design made by the French artist Jean-Pierre Lihou in 1976, will be presented from the Conservatoire,
  • The “M 35″, Citroën’s very rare ambition to commercialize the Wankel engine, will complement the presentation of the 3 newcomers from 1970 which jointly will be celebrated.
  • The “creative technology” (Citroën’s brand claim) of the famous history of the past will be reflected by a presentation of the latest Citroën DS3, bridging the gap from the history to the present.
